The global Structural Heart Devices market is estimated to be valued at USD 16.7 billion in 2026 and is projected to reach USD 48.2 billion by 2036, expanding at a CAGR of 11.2% during the forecast period. The report provides a comprehensive evaluation of the cardiovascular medical technology landscape addressing defects and abnormalities in the heart's valves and chambers, examining market trends, technological advancements, competitive developments, and future growth opportunities across the value chain.

Structural heart devices, including transcatheter heart valves, annuloplasty rings, and septal occluders, are transforming the treatment of aortic stenosis, mitral regurgitation, and congenital heart defects by enabling minimally invasive and percutaneous approaches that reduce the risks associated with open-heart surgery. As the global population continues to age and the prevalence of valvular heart disease rises, structural heart devices have become essential for delivering safer, more accessible cardiovascular care. Hospitals and specialized cardiac centers across the globe are increasingly adopting these technologies as clinical evidence continues to expand their use across a broader range of patient risk profiles.

Market Dynamics

The aging global population and the resulting rise in age-related heart conditions remain among the primary drivers of the market, as aortic stenosis and mitral regurgitation are significantly more common among older adults and require structural heart devices for repair or replacement. The expansion of clinical indications for transcatheter aortic valve replacement, from high-risk to low-risk patient populations, has significantly increased the eligible patient base and reinforced adoption. Continuous improvement in device delivery systems, which are becoming smaller and more flexible, is further supporting safer procedures and broader clinical uptake.

Despite this momentum, several challenges continue to influence adoption. The high cost of structural heart procedures and associated devices, including hospitalization and specialized imaging, can place a significant burden on healthcare budgets, and inadequate reimbursement in emerging markets can limit adoption of these technologies. The risk of complications such as stroke or conduction disturbances requiring permanent pacemaker implantation remains a concern for clinicians and patients, and the stringent regulatory pathways required for new device approvals can be costly and time-consuming for manufacturers.

The market nevertheless presents significant long-term opportunities. The development of transcatheter therapies for the mitral and tricuspid valves represents a substantial growth avenue, as these segments remain in the early stages of development relative to the mature TAVR market. The growth of left atrial appendage closure devices as an alternative to long-term oral anticoagulation for stroke prevention in atrial fibrillation patients is expected to see particularly strong growth as more patients seek alternatives to blood thinners.

Segment Analysis

The report provides detailed market analysis across product, indication, end user, and geography, enabling stakeholders to identify high-growth business opportunities and evolving customer requirements.

Based on product, heart valve devices hold the largest share of the market, driven by the established clinical success of TAVR and the high unit cost of transcatheter valves, with TAVR alone accounting for over 50% of total market revenue. Occluders and closure devices are expected to register a significant growth rate, driven by rapid expansion of the left atrial appendage closure market and increasing use of septal occluders for treating congenital heart defects such as patent foramen ovale and atrial septal defect.

From an indication perspective, valvular heart disease accounts for a leading share given its high prevalence among the aging population, affecting an estimated 13% of individuals aged 75 and older. By end user, hospitals with dedicated structural heart programs represent the largest share of demand, supported by the multidisciplinary expertise required for these procedures.

Regional Analysis

The report provides comprehensive market analysis across North America, Europe, Asia-Pacific, Latin America, and the Middle East & Africa. Regional evaluations consider clinical adoption rates, reimbursement frameworks, healthcare infrastructure maturity, and demographic trends influencing market growth.

North America currently accounts for the largest share of the global market, supported by advanced healthcare infrastructure, high clinical adoption of new technologies, and favorable reimbursement policies, along with a strong presence of leading device manufacturers. Europe continues to demonstrate steady growth, underpinned by established structural heart programs and expanding clinical experience across major markets.

Asia-Pacific is expected to register the fastest growth throughout the forecast period, driven by rapid digitalization in healthcare, increasing medical technology investment in China and India, and a rising geriatric population. Latin America and the Middle East & Africa are also expected to offer emerging opportunities as structural heart programs and cardiac care infrastructure continue to develop.
